Would you like to check out a book from the Santiago Library?
Even though the library is only open by appointment during cohort time, you can place a hold on a book through our Destiny Library in MyCNUSD, and then pick it up at the library between your cohort classes. Just knock at the doors facing the quad for book pick-up, return, or help. If you need to come during class, your teacher can call ahead to make an appointment for you to come to the library. Care Solace
- Care Solace is an online resource with a live 24x7 concierge line meant to assist individuals in finding local mental health-related programs and counseling services.
- To use Care Solace, individuals answer ten basic questions in order to receive an extensive list of referrals to applicable care providers. Care Solace takes into account all types of private insurance including Medi-Cal, Medicaid, and Medicare and those that have no insurance. The system also filters by age, gender, zip code, and special request.
- Care Solace is now available for use by CNUSD students, staff, and families at no cost. Please note, this service is an optional resource available by choice and is not mandatory in any way. Care Solace does not require a user’s name, address, phone number, or date of birth.
